Hakim Ziyech Loses Potential Move to CFR Cluj
Free Agent Status
Former Chelsea and Ajax winger Hakim Ziyech remains without a club after failing to secure a move to Romania’s CFR Cluj.
Negotiations Come to a Halt
Recent discussions regarding Ziyech’s transfer have come to an end, as club owner Ioan Varga announced the decision to withdraw from negotiations.
Varga remarked, “Ziyech was unable to proceed due to an issue with his left knee that I was informed about. He is an exceptional individual, but I cannot justify investing a substantial amount for a player who may have health concerns.”
He added, “In watching him play with Galatasaray, he appeared to show signs of trepidation on the field.”
Decision to Move On
The club’s management ultimately resolved to terminate the talks. Varga expressed regret over the situation, stating, “It’s unfortunate because he is a unique talent, but the risks were too great for us.”
He further explained, “Ziyech was asking for an annual salary of 2.5 million euros, a figure I couldn’t offer to a player whose fitness was uncertain.”
Varga concluded with well wishes for Ziyech, hoping he recovers and finds success with another team while affirming that CFR Cluj will pursue healthier alternatives to strengthen their squad.
